Why Regular Sewer Upkeep Saves You Hundreds
Most homeowners hardly ever think about their sewer system until something goes wrong. By then, the damage is messy, stressful, and expensive. Regular sewer upkeep is without doubt one of the smartest preventive steps you possibly can take to protect your home, your health, and your bank account.
Your sewer line is accountable for carrying all wastewater away from your sinks, bogs, showers, and appliances. Over time, grease, soap residue, food particles, hair, and other debris build up along the inside of the pipes. Tree roots may also invade small cracks in underground lines, slowly expanding and causing major blockages. Without routine upkeep, these small points turn into critical problems.
One of the biggest ways maintenance saves cash is by stopping major clogs. A simple blockage might start with slow drains or occasional gurgling sounds. If ignored, pressure builds in the pipe until wastewater has nowhere to go. This can lead to sewage backing up into your sinks, tubs, or even your basement floor drains. Cleanup costs for a sewage backup can simply reach 1000's of dollars, particularly if flooring, drywall, or personal belongings are damaged.
Regular sewer inspections and cleanings catch these issues early. Professionals use specialised cameras to examine the inside of your pipes and establish buildup, cracks, or root intrusion earlier than a full blockage occurs. Cleaning methods like hydro jetting remove cussed debris and grease from the pipe walls, restoring proper flow. The cost of routine service is minor compared to emergency repairs and restoration.
Another major financial benefit comes from avoiding pipe damage. When clogs and pressure persist, pipes can crack, collapse, or separate at the joints. Underground sewer line repairs typically require digging up landscaping, driveways, or sidewalks. This type of work is labor intensive and expensive. In extreme cases, a full sewer line replacement could also be necessary, which can cost as a lot as a small home renovation.
Maintenance helps extend the lifespan of your sewer system. By keeping pipes clear and identifying small structural issues early, you reduce stress on the system and avoid premature failure. Think of it like changing the oil in your car. A small, regular investment keeps everything running smoothly and prevents catastrophic breakdowns.
Health risks are one other costly factor many homeowners overlook. Sewage comprises harmful micro organism, viruses, and parasites. A backup inside your home creates a serious health hazard that will require professional sanitation services. Medical bills, time without work work, and temporary relocation expenses can add up quickly. Preventive maintenance significantly lowers the risk of those harmful situations.
Insurance is just not always a safety net either. Many customary homeowners insurance policies don't absolutely cover sewer backups or underground pipe failures. Even when partial coverage is available, deductibles and coverage limits can go away you paying a large portion out of pocket. Spending a small quantity every year on maintenance may also help you avoid relying on unsure insurance claims.
Regular sewer care also protects your property value. Prospective buyers are wary of homes with plumbing or sewer issues. A history of backups or major repairs can make a house harder to sell or reduce its market price. Then again, documented maintenance shows that the system has been properly cared for, which builds purchaser confidence.
Simple habits at home also help professional maintenance. Keep away from flushing wipes, paper towels, hygiene products, and grease down the drain. Use drain strainers to catch hair and food particles. These small actions reduce the load in your sewer system and make professional cleanings even more effective.
Sewer problems hardly ever fix themselves. They grow quietly underground until they become emergencies. Common maintenance keeps minor issues from turning into monetary disasters, helping you keep away from repair bills, property damage, and health risks that may easily total thousands of dollars.
